Miller" , Jakub Kicinski , netdev@vger.kernel.org, lin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org Subject: [RFC PATCH net-next] net: dsa: tag_qca: Check for upstream VLAN tag Date: Sat, 5 Jun 2021 20:37:48 +0100 Message-Id: <20210605193749.730836-1-mnhagan88@gmail.com> X-Mailer: git-send-email 2.26.3 M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Transfer-Encoding: quoted-printable To: unlisted-recipients:; (no To-header on input) Precedence: bulk List-ID: X-Mailing-List: lin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org X-ZohoMail-DKIM: fail (Header signature does not verify) Content-Type: text/plain; charset="utf-8" The qca_tag_rcv function unconditionally expects a QCA tag to be present between source MAC and EtherType. However if an upstream switch is used, this may create a special case where VLAN tags are subsequently inserted between the source MAC and the QCA tag. Thus when qca_tag_rcv is called, it will attempt to read the 802.1q TPID as a QCA tag. This results in complication since the TPID will pass the QCA tag version checking on bits 14 and 15, but the resulting packet after trimming the TPID will be unusable. The tested case is a Meraki MX65 which features two QCA8337 switches with their CPU ports attached to a BCM58625 switch ports 4 and 5 respectively. In this case a VLAN tag with VID 0 is added by the upstream BCM switch when the port is unconfigured and packets with this VLAN tag or without will be accepted at the BCM's CPU port. However, it is arguably possible that other switches may be configured to drop VLAN untagged traffic at their respective CPU port. Thus where packets are VLAN untagged, the default VLAN tag, added by the upstream switch, should be maintained. Where inbound packets are already VLAN tagged when arriving at the QCA switch, we should replace the default VLAN tag, added by the upstream port, with the correct VLAN tag. This patch introduces: 1 - A check for a VLAN tag before EtherType. If found, skip past this to find the QCA tag. 2 - Check for a second VLAN tag after the QCA tag if one was found in 1. If found, remove both the initial VLAN tag and the QCA tag. If not found, remove only the QCA tag to maintain the VLAN tag added by the upstream switch.
